  • @broadwayxdude06 The main difference between sopranos and mezzosopranos is that sopranos will use head voice. Even Emma isn't fully in head voice here, she is mixing the high notes. Mezzosopranos sing lower than sopranos do, but use chest voice and belt high notes. This has become a more popular voice type recently because of pop music's love of belting high notes, and broadway has emulated that in recent years by using mostly mezzosoprano leads.
